Any peace deal between Kyiv and Moscow must not “sell Ukraine out” – British Foreign Minister

The Minister of Foreign Affairs of the United Kingdom Liz Truss stated that Ukraine should not “be sold” in peace talks with Russia.

Source: British Foreign Minister Liz Truss

“We need to ensure that any future talks don’t end up selling Ukraine out or the repetition of past mistakes,” said Truss.

According to her, Russian President Vladimir Putin should not benefit from the invasion of Ukraine.

“We remember an uneasy settlement of 2014, which failed to give Ukraine lasting security. Putin just came back for more. That is why we cannot allow him to win from this appalling aggression,” she told parliament.

Earlier, British Prime Minister Boris Johnson said that Ukraine was now “paying” for the fact that the West did not understand the threat posed by Vladimir Putin for many years.
